Our Aims and direction

At Camden Tennis Academy, our aims are two fold. Firstly, to promote the game of tennis in the Camden and surrounding areas. Secondly, to provide the opportunity to learn the basic technical and tactical skills to improve their game and thus their overall enjoyment of the sport.  

This of course applies to both junior and senior players. We do this by actively promoting the game throughout the Camden and surrounding districts with adverisements, fliers, internet and word of mouth. To assist these new students of the game we provide numerous coaching options to train and educate these students to play and enjoy the game.

$300 Junior Comp Winners: WRG Div 2

Team Mercedes scoops $210 for their win in the junior comp and Team Porsche R/up $90.

Ryan Sakowicz, Jordon Evans and Maddison Newport were the big grinners at the end of the Winners R Grinners - Div2 Junior Tennis competition just completed.

Each player took home $75 and were very worthy winners, defeating Team Porsche in the final. Great effort boys and girls, we wish you luck in the next one.
